I swapped my Model S for a Lincoln this morning. The Lincoln just had some things the Tesla didn't. My windshield stress cracked and I just couldn't live with it.

19" turbine wheels

Nice blue/green flecked metallic black color

Cup holders that don't suck, and a center console to hide my trash.

Real headlamp controls

Lots of buttons on the steering wheel, there is an identical set on the other side.

A real screen. The one on the Model S is too big.

Floor mats that don't suck, and actually attach to the floor and don't flop down.

A spare tire

A thinner key fob, with buttons that don't have plastic circles fall out of it.

And I swapped back for my Model S today.

Auto brights don't work worth a crap. I was blinding people, and the car kept turning of my brights on pitch black roads with the Lincoln MKS.

The sun visors were about 3x bigger than the Model S's, and the back seats were nicer. But it couldn't hold a candle to the Model S.
